BEN MULRONEY
Host of Canadian Idol & eTalk Daily
Affable and urbane, Ben Mulroney’s role as host of CTV's Canadian Idol and eTalk Daily, couldn't be a better fit. A self-confessed pop culture junkie, Mulroney is front and centre on eTalk Daily, covering all aspects of the fast-paced celebrity world from red carpets to a behind the scenes look at blockbuster films. Mulroney has brought the Idol phenomenon to life for Canadian viewers, from talent auditions across the country to the nail-biting season finale. You do not need to be a Canadian Idol fan to appreciate Ben's enthusiasm, natural charm and easy-going style. His professionalism on stage translates naturally to many audiences.
Mulroney got his broadcasting start as the Quebec City correspondent for Talk TV's the chatroom, where he beamed in weekly via Web cam to rant and rave about television. He became a co-host on the interactive show in July 2001. He moved to a new role of entertainment reporter for CTV’s Canada AM in October 2001, reviewing the newest releases and the hottest shows. Additionally, Mulroney is the host of the national Canadian radio countdown show, etalk20. Since 2002, he has covered red carpet arrivals for the Academy Awards, the Golden Globes, the SAG Awards and the Emmy’s. He has been the co-host of CTV’s At The Junos, the red carpet pre-show at the Juno Awards.
As the son of former Prime Minister Brian Mulroney, you would think Ben would naturally have gravitated toward politics. With a law degree from Laval University, in Quebec City, and a history degree from Duke University, Mulroney’s choice to work in television might surprise a lot of people. His legal degree affords him flexibility to pursue his passions – movies, television, film and politics.
